I got it to work by:
1) Modifying my appcfg.py code. Added a mimetype. Details below.
2) check my html and file names for case (the online google app engine
is case sensitive)
File: C:\google_appengine\google\appengine\tools\appcfg.py
Towards the bottom in function "main" needs to run this line (i made
it the first line):
mimetypes.add_type("application/xaml", ".xaml")

> How do I use the upload tool (appcfg.py) and my app.yaml file to
> upload .XAML (silverlight) files?
>
> Here are the handlers in my yaml:
> handlers:
> - url: /stylesheets
> static_dir: stylesheets
>
> - url: /silverlight
> static_dir: silverlight
>
> - url: /.*
> script: helloworld.py
>
> My xaml and such is in the silverlight directory. My appcfg.py
> command is:
> appcfg.py update C:\GoogleAppsProjects\HelloWorld
>
> When I try to do it I get this:
> "Could not guess mimetype for silverlight/scene.xaml. Using
> application/octet-stream."
>
> And the uploaded xaml file doesn't work. By the way, the localhost
> version of the app runs fine. It's the upload tool that is screwing
> something up.
